NIGHT CLUB HULA HAWAIIAN STYLE
A Musical Stroll Into The Clubs Of 1940’s Waikiki

A musical stroll into the clubs of 1940’s Waikiki. Night Club Hula will transport you back in time! It’s 1946. World War II has just ended and you find yourself in Waikiki strolling down Kalakaua Ave. Warm trade winds blow gently and you are intoxicated by the heady scent of ginger & pikake. Sweet sounds drift though an open night club door & you find yourself listening to Alfred Apaka, Pua Almeida & Randy Oness. You move on to the night club next door only to find the incomparable Gabby Pahinui & Andy Cummings. Just down the block Jules Ah See & Bill Aliiloa Lincoln are playing. Across the street you find the Royal Hawaiian Serenaders, Alvin Kaleolani Isaacs, Mel Peterson, George Kainapau & George Archer and his Pagans. Then The Kalima Brothers & Richard Kauhi, George Pokini’s Hawaiians, Josephine Ikuwa, Alice Davis, & Thelma Anahu. Unbelievable talent! The evening continues and so does your musical stroll into the clubs of 1940’s Waikiki. Listen to the most gifted, talented,
& famous Hawaiian entertainers of the day!
